A while back there was a fascinating talk delivered by Kevin Worthen, President of Brigham Young University on Post Truth.  He introduced his talk with this dictionary version of “Post Truth:”

Each year, Oxford Dictionaries selects a word of the year—“a word, or expression, that is judged to reflect the mood of that particular year and to have lasting potential as a word of cultural significance.”  Past selections include “unfriend” in 2009 and “selfie” in 2013. In 2015 the word of the year was not a word but a pictograph: the “face with tears of joy” emoji.

Recently, Oxford Dictionaries announced that the word of the year for 2016 is post-truth, a word they define as “an adjective . . . denoting circumstances in which objective facts are less influential in shaping public opinion that appeals to emotion and personal belief. I wouldn’t be surprised if post-truth becomes one of the defining words of our time.” Reflecting this view, several commentators have recently asserted that we live in a post-truth world, or a world in which truth “has become unimportant or irrelevant.” ( Just look at CNN.)

He went on to explain that it is hard to know with certainty whether truth is really less important than it has been in the past.  But it is clear that because we live in a digital age, in which there is so much information and there are so many different contending views of what is accurate, some people find that new information confounds and confuses rather than clarifies and enlightens. Modernizing the plight of the thirsty Ancient Mariner, who proclaimed, “Water, water, everywhere, nor any drop to drink,” many today lament, “Data, data, everywhere, and not a thought to think.”
